§ 57-30-4 — Information provided by seller

Text
A. A person attempting to sell regulated material to a secondhand metal dealer shall:
(1)display to the secondhand metal dealer the person's personal identification document;
(2)sign a written statement provided by the secondhand metal dealer that the person is the legal owner of or is lawfully entitled to sell the regulated material offered for sale;
(3)provide to the secondhand metal dealer the year, make, model and license plate number of the motor vehicle used to transport the regulated material; and (4) allow the secondhand metal dealer to take a photograph of the seller and the regulated material.
